Q.

25.0 mL sample of 0.15 M silver nitrate AgNO3 is reacted with a 3.58 g sample of calcium chloride CaCl2(M=111.0) Which of the following statements is true?

a

Calcium chloride is the limiting reactant and silver chloride precipitates.

b

Silver nitrate is the limiting reactant and silver chloride precipitates.

c

Calcium chloride is the limiting reactant and calcium nitrate precipitates

d

Silver nitrate is the limiting reactant and calcium nitrate precipitates.

answer is B.
